Output 8586bcdf31b462b6a285efc6259fb28f08ac6c30962375519eee7304263b2069:0

value
64756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2856ff1d4e23e56d7ac9716c8a8d5c46c295244b OP_EQUAL
address
35NKAqpmXyt7US6AWY9MK3fYy1HBvnSSMx
transaction
8586bcdf31b462b6a285efc6259fb28f08ac6c30962375519eee7304263b2069
spent
true